WebThe interstory drift index is defined as interstory displacement, δs,i, divided by story height, hi. Thus, it defines the average rotation angle each beam-column subassembly in a given … Web29 Jul 2024 · For dynamic response spectrum results it is also important to know how CQC (or SRSS) are employed in evaluating the story displacements With RAM Structural System, we evaluate the drift for each mode, then combine those diaphragm drift results using the same CQC methods that we use for member forces or nodal displacements, but this …

Web7 Nov 2024 · Site Coefficients. A site coefficient, F a, and F v should be defined as well. The site coefficients, F a and F v, can be found from Tables 1613.3.3(1) and 1613.3.3(2) of the International Building Code (IBC) 2012 respectively.Table 1613.3.3(1) requires knowing the site class of the structural building location and the mapped spectral response … Web9 Apr 2024 · Structural engineering tools to quickly and interactively verify drift requirements in ETABS model.
